Eye of the Kraken
The original story begins on a sailing ship on the high seas. An important document needs to be delivered to Heard Island as soon as possible, and you, Abdullah, have been chosen as its courier. But before you can arrive, your journey is interrupted when you receive a letter from your friend Titien with an urgent message. Titien has informed you that the 'Eye of the Kraken' has been stolen and that the culprit is aboard the very ship you are on. He has also told you to find the eye and catch the thief. You, of course, do as your friend asks and search for the culprit.
In general, the game is not linear, and some things can be done in any order. Most of the puzzles are object or inventory based, and none have a time limit. Some of the objects are pointless and are included to increase the comedy factor. You must locate and talk to the numerous animated characters that move around the ship. Conversations are text only, and descriptions of objects and locations also appear on the screen.
The backgrounds are colorful 2D graphics, drawn from an isometric perspective. The outdoor scenery changes between day and night; background music can be selected in-game.
